Head of People Analytics

Location: Zurich

Apply for this role(opens in a new tab)

In short

Our Talent (HR) team is expanding to support On’s growth, and we are looking for a strategic and inspiring leader to join us as our Head of People Analytics. This role is for a seasoned professional with extensive experience in building and leading an analytics function, ideally in a fast-paced, global environment. The role is ideal for someone with an entrepreneurial spirit who can set the vision for people analytics, drive business value, and build a high-performing team.

Your Mission

  • Leadership & Strategy: Build, lead, and mentor a high-performing People Analytics and Talent Data team. Define and execute the strategic roadmap for people analytics, aligning it with high-priority business and talent objectives.
  • Commercial Mindset: Operate with a ‘business impact’ mindset; demonstrate strong commercial acumen to translate data-driven insights into strategic business decisions that drive measurable value and improve organizational performance. A key focus will be supporting our growing retail business.
  • Analysis & Insights: Conduct and oversee advanced data analysis to identify trends, patterns, and insights related to the entire employee lifecycle, including employee listening, talent and performance management, learning and development, and diversity & inclusion.
  • Storytelling & Influence: Develop and deliver compelling, data-driven stories and presentations that effectively communicate insights and recommendations to senior audiences, including C-Suite and HR Leadership teams.
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Act as a thought leader and strategic partner to HR Business Partners, Centers of Excellence, and business leaders. Proactively identify opportunities for analysis, manage project roadmaps, and keep stakeholders informed of progress.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Build key relationships and collaborate across functions, including HR, Finance, and Strategy, to support long range growth and workforce planning.
  • Continuous Improvement: Stay up-to-date with industry trends and emerging themes in the people analytics domain, identifying opportunities to introduce external perspectives, enhance our analytical capabilities, and maximize impact.
  • Data Integrity & Governance: Champion data integrity and governance. Demonstrate exceptional judgment and discretion when dealing with highly sensitive people data, including partnering with Data Privacy & Governance teams to ensure compliance and obtain approvals.

    Your story

    • 10-15+ years of progressive experience in the data analytics field, with a significant focus on People/HR/Talent analytics.
    • Proven experience in a leadership role, with a track record of building and managing analytics teams.
    • A firm grasp of how to best use quantitative and qualitative analytical strategies to inform strategic business and talent decisions.
    • Expertise in developing and delivering compelling data-driven narratives to executive-level audiences.
    • Strong business and commercial acumen, with the ability to connect people data to business outcomes.
    • Expert-level reporting skills and proficiency with statistical tools (e.g., R, Python, SPSS) and data visualization tools (e.g., One Model, Visier).
    • Experience with Workday is a strong advantage.
    •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ence and build relationships at all levels of the organization.
    • Highly detail-oriented with a commitment to precision and data integrity.
